Title: Dhugal Lindsay: Innovator in Underwater Exploration Technology
Introduction
Dhugal Lindsay is a notable inventor based in Yokosuka,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of underwater exploration technology, holding 2 patents that showcase his innovative approach to image recording and data processing.
Latest Patents
Lindsay's latest patents include an image recording method and a connectedly-formed underwater exploration device. The image recording method involves acquiring video images from multiple cameras during specific lighting conditions, detecting luminance differences between frames, and recording these images with associated timestamps. This method enhances the quality and relevance of the captured data. The connectedly-formed underwater exploration device addresses the need for multi-directional image recording and various observations during deep-sea exploration. It features a battery-driven underwater exploration body with pressure-resistant glass spheres that house essential devices for capturing and processing images, as well as communication and control systems.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Dhugal Lindsay has worked with esteemed organizations such as the Japan Agency for Marine-Earth Science and Technology and Okamoto Glass Co., Ltd. His experience in these institutions has allowed him to develop and refine his innovative ideas in underwater technology.
Collaborations
Lindsay has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Tetsuya Miwa and Masafumi Shimotashiro. Their combined expertise has contributed to the advancement of underwater exploration technologies.
